Structure of 14-3-3 sigma in complex with PADI6 14-3-3 binding motif II
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 22634725
About this Structure
4dat is a 2 chain structure with sequence from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
Reference
- Rose R, Rose M, Ottmann C. Identification and structural characterization of two 14-3-3 binding sites in the human peptidylarginine deiminase type VI. J Struct Biol. 2012 May 24. PMID:22634725 doi:10.1016/j.jsb.2012.05.010
